Filter for Graco 1.5 Gallon Cool Mist Humidifier For use in the Graco Cool Mist Humidifier 1.5 Gallon Daily Output. Fits the following: Graco Model 2H00 TrueAir Model 05510 Each easy-to-replace drop-in filter can be changed in about a minute. Replace the filter when it becomes hard to the touch or shows discoloration (which is caused by mineral deposits or mold/mildew buildup).

I purchased this filter for my Graco home humidifier. I regularly performed operational maintenance on my humidifier, including washing the filter. Despite the maintenance the filter slowly became discolored from the natural pollutants and minerals contained in my water. This Graco Filter helped solve my problem.
I carefully care for the filter. To avoid frequently replacing the filter, I use a procedure that can extend the life of the filter. When the filter forms a crust, I soak it for awhile in vinegar water (usually 1 part vinegar to 4 parts water). After soaking I carefully rinse the filter several times in fresh water.
The Graco humidifier that I use is an evaporation style machine. To work properly, the "filter" must be free of pollutants, as the machine adds moisture to the air by having a fan blow air through the sponge type filter (exactly like the "swamp coolers" so popular in arid climates). Clogs decrease effectiveness and add pollutants to the air in the room being used. Accordingly, in addition to carefully maintaining the filter, I add KAZ Humidifier Bacteriostatic Treatment to the reservoir to prevent the growth of bacterial agents.
